WebResearch has shown that the intersection angle of driveways should not be skewed from 90 degrees by more than 15 to 20 degrees. Suggested limiting values of two-way driveway angles are: Anchor: #FXWWTVUU. Private Residential Driveway: 75 degrees; Anchor: #UMTFUCPA. WebThe sizing of the culvert crossing is for an average year storm. Blockage, larger storms, rapid snowmelt, and debris flows all endanger the roadway and crossing. A prudent designer purposely will depress the road grade to allow for a storm-flow section equal to twice the cross-sectional area developed in Rule 2 to pass over the roadway. WebEffects Advantages. WebThe Manual on Uniform Traffic Control Devices for Streets and Highways, or MUTCD defines the standards used by road managers nationwide to install and maintain traffic control devices on all public streets, highways, bikeways, and private roads open to public travel. WebLog pond areas should be well drained. Spoon drains (3-4 metres wide and 30 cm deep), constructed at a maximum interval of 40 metres will channel runoff to vegetated outlets. The maximum slope of spoon drains should be 1-3%. The major crossing points of drains should be gravelled to a depth of 30 cm. The intersection may be designed like an intersection between cycle tracks (using speed bumps, ramps, slopes up to the road) or like a crossing with side roads where the pavement or verge is designed as a raised surface using paving slabs, chaussée stones, etc. riddick 2013 hindi dubbed movie watch onlineWebApr 4, 2016 · At stop and yield controlled intersections, maximum cross slope is 2% . At signal controlled intersections, maximum cross slope is 5%. At midblock crossings, maximum cross slope is the highway grade. Max running grade of the crosswalk < 5%.
